Do I Need a Roof Inspection After a Storm in Lakeland?

Yes, if the storm left water in the house, a stain that grew during the rain, missing shingles, daylight in the attic, or a limb on the deck. A dry roof with a few granules in the gutter can often wait until morning. An active leak cannot.

Call tonight

Water dripping inside. A ceiling that is sagging or bulging. A hole or a missing section. Daylight through the attic. A tree on the roof.

Stay off the wet deck. Photograph from the ground and from inside. Bucket under the drip. Close the door on a bulging ceiling. Do not poke the bulge.

That first visit is often emergency roof repair. If we cannot close the opening the same night, we tarp so the next band does not keep feeding the attic. How long a tarp holds: how long can a tarp stay on a roof in Florida.

Wait until morning

A few missing shingles and a dry ceiling. Granules in the gutter and no stain. Wind you heard, nothing you can see from the yard.

Book the free inspection the next day anyway if a named storm or a hail cell came through. Damage hides at boots, valleys, and the ridge. Dixieland low-pitch roofs hold water. Cleveland Heights oaks drop limbs you notice after the sun is up.

What we check after a Lakeland cell

The field for lifted or missing shingles. Flashing at chimneys, vents, and skylights. Attic insulation for wet spots. Interior ceilings. Then photos and a written list of what needs work now and what can wait.

If the leak is a boot, that is roof leak repair. If a plane is stripped, we measure the section, not just the hole, because Florida’s 25% roofing rule can turn a patch into a code upgrade. Age letters are a different statute: the 15 year roof rule.
